Connan Mockasin – Caramel (from the album Caramel, Phantasy)



If the out there New Zealander’s second album is a trip to the outer galaxies of Deep Funk, this is the luscious, succinct theme tune. Glassy guitars, a sensual vocal of Prince proportions and an insidious tune make this essential romantic music.



Mention as well to the album’s lead single ‘I’m the man, that will find you’ which is strange and wonderful in equal measure. Its combination of falsetto with on-helium singing makes the title refrain seem like the kind of creepy promise you might feel compelled to (probably ill-advisedly) encourage.
